US equity ownership is heavily skewed toward older generations:
Baby Boomers now hold XX% of all US corporate equities and mutual fund shares, down only slightly from XX% in Q1 2020.
By comparison, Millennials own just X% of all equities, up from ~2% in 2020.
Gen X accounts for 22%, roughly unchanged over the same period.
Meanwhile, the Silent Generation still holds 16%, experiencing a decline from XX% seen X years ago.
In other words, ~70% of all equities remain in the hands of Americans born before 1965.
The generational wealth divide is massive.
